Abstract:
To provide a highly efficient ejector.SOLUTION: An ejector 1 comprises: a cylindrical nozzle 10F having a nozzle hole 11; and a main body part 20 which is arranged so as to form a suction passage part 21 of a suction flow at a periphery of the nozzle 10F, and a merging part 22 of a drive flow and the suction flow on an extension line of a tip opening 11a of the nozzle 10F. The ejector sucks the suction flow into the merging part 22 by injecting the drive flow from the tip opening 11a of the nozzle 10F, and mixes the drive flow and the suction flow at the merging part 22. The nozzle 10F comprises a plurality of spiral flow passage walls 40 for imparting a force in a rotation direction so as to straddle a boundary between the drive flow and the suction flow at a plane vertical to a center axis L at an internal peripheral face, and a plurality of spiral flow passage walls 46 arranged at an external peripheral face, and imparting a force in a rotation direction so as to straddle a boundary between the drive flow and the suction flow at a plane vertical to the center axis L. The flow passage walls 40 and the flow passage walls 46 are inverted with respect to each other in spiral directions.SELECTED DRAWING: Figure 9
